Can't open containers in spectator mode in a block
The bug
If you are inside of a block in spectator mode, it considers you to be "looking at" the block you are in. This means that you can't look in containers. This makes it difficult to look in chests in mineshafts or strongholds. This will happen in any game mode, but it's only a bug in spectator mode.

Confirmed for 14w31a, but I am not sure if it I would call it a 'bug'. If you are inside a block, the game considers you to be 'looking at' the block you are inside, and does not register that you are looking at the chest or entity outside of the block. I believe it has always been this way (but it was not of concern before the introduction of Spectator Mode). The F3 screen's "Looking at:" coordinates are evidence of this.
But I do think it would be good if this was changed for spectator mode, to allow clicking through/inside blocks (within reach).
